Rearrange Your Mental
Furniture
 

We are used to books, films and radio programs challenging our assumptions on subjects. Adam Curtis, Louis Theroux and David Attenborough have powerfully used film to change perspectives and values.

Less well-known is how many video games tread a similar furrow. These are games that not only tackle difficult subjects but get beneath the usual binary perspectives to create new ways of thinking about these themes.
 
This list includes 79 games from the last 28 years, with 1,845 likes. They come from a range of different genres and play-styles and are all good games if you want to re-think your assumptions.
